Selecting the Perfect End Mill Tool for Every Job
End mills are essential cutting tools utilized in a variety of machining operations. With precision drilling to intricate shaping, these versatile tools can accomplish a wide range of tasks. To ensure optimal website results, it's crucial to select the appropriate end mill type for each specific job.
A fundamental consideration is the material being machined. Different materials require distinct end mill geometries and coatings. For instance, high-speed steel (HSS) end mills are well-suited for metal alloys, while carbide end mills excel in cutting hardened materials.
Moreover, the type of operation influences end mill selection. For roughing applications, which involve removing large amounts of material, large end mills with multiple flutes are preferred. In contrast, finishing operations demand smaller, finer end mills for achieving precise surface smoothness.
Ultimately, understanding the various end mill types and their respective applications is key to achieving successful machining results.
